The Delhi Transport Corporation (DTC) is exploring options to enhance public transport connectivity in the National Capital Region (NCR), with discussions underway to operate e-buses to the upcoming Jewar International Airport in Noida.

Officials at the DTC bus centre in Sector 16A said that while current bus services already provide excellent connectivity from Delhi to Gurugram and Delhi Airport, preparations are being made to meet the growing demand for transport to Jewar Airport once it becomes operational.

“The use of Jewar International Airport is expected to rise rapidly in the coming years,” DTC officials noted. “Keeping plans in mind, we have begun deliberations to introduce e-bus services to ensure convenient and sustainable travel for passengers.”

The officials added that the operation of these e-buses will commence once the DTC receives the new fleet of electric buses.
